Abstract

This research is a quantitative study motivated by the large number of students who do not yet understand the correct investment concepts, due to low financial literacy levels and unstable incomes. This study aims to analyze the influence of financial literacy and income on the investment interest of students at Perwira Purbalingga University. All active students of Perwira Purbalingga University constitute the population, from which a sample of 50 respondents was taken using purposive sampling technique. In conducting data analysis, multiple linear regression analysis was used on the IBM SPSS 27 software, sourced from primary data in the form of a Likert scale questionnaire. The results show that financial literacy and income have a positive and significant impact on investment interest. These findings indicate that an increase in financial literacy can enhance students' interest in investing, while higher income provides flexibility in financial management and participation in investments. .

Abstract

This study aims to determine the elasticity of labor demand in Southeast Sulawesi Province. This type of research is quantitative research with data sources from BPS. The analysis tool used is the labor demand elasticity formula. The findings of this study are that in 2024 the elasticity of labor demand is elastic, while in 2023 and 2022 it is inelastic. The implication is that the government must be careful in determining policies related to minimum wages because it will act quickly on labor demand.

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the influence of Regional Land and Building Tax (PBB) and royalties from mineral and coal natural resources (SDA Minerba) on Revenue Sharing Funds (DBH) across all provinces in Kalimantan during the 2022–2024 period. The data used are secondary data, including the realization of PBB, Minerba royalties, and DBH from local government financial reports. The study adopts a quantitative approach using panel data regression and the Fixed Effect Model, selected based on Chow and Hausman tests. The results show that Minerba royalties have a statistically significant effect on DBH, whereas Regional PBB does not show a significant influence. These findings indicate that revenue from extractive sectors plays a dominant role in shaping regional fiscal capacity in Kalimantan. The study recommends optimizing PBB collection and diversifying revenue sources to strengthen sustainable regional fiscal structures.

Abstract

Earnings management is an action carried out by a manager by manipulating financial reports with the aim of benefiting himself (the manager) and the company's profits. This research aims to determine the effect of free cash flow, leverage and audit quality on earnings management, moderated by company size. The population in this research is 55 companies in the consumer goods industry sector listed on the IDX in 2019-2023. The sampling technique in this research was purposive sampling. The sample in this research was 15 companies. This research uses a multiple linear regression test data analysis method with the IBM SPSS Statistics 26 program. The results of this research indicate that leverage and audit quality have a positive and significant effect on earnings management. Meanwhile, free cash flow has no negative and significant effect on earnings management. Company size is able to strengthen free cash flow, leverage, and audit quality on earnings management.

Abstract

The study intended to explore how job satisfaction and organizational commitment affect organizational citizenship behavior (OCB) at PT. Karya Mekar Dewatamali. A total of 194 employees were included in the research population at PT. Karya Mekar Dewatamali, and 49 employees were selected as the sample using incidental sampling. The research was based on a quantitative approach. Data processing included descriptive statistics, data quality testing (including vailidity and reliability tests), classical assumption testing (including normality, multicollinearity, and heteroscedasticity tests), multiple linear regression analysis, and hypothesis testing. The results of these findings include the following: (1) job satisfaction has a significant and positive relationship with organizational citizenship behavior (OCB) at PT. Karya Mekar Dewatamali. (2) Organizational commitment has a significant and positive relationship with OCB at PT. Karya Mekar Dewatamali. Third, job satisfaction and organizational commitment have a significant, positive relationship with OCB at PT. Karya Mekar Dewatamali.

Abstract

The phenomenon of doom spending, or impulsive consumption behavior as an emotional escape, has become increasingly prevalent amid global economic uncertainty. Economic crises, high inflation, and job insecurity are key drivers of irrational consumer behavior. This study aims to systematically review the literature examining the relationship between macroeconomic pressures, doom spending behavior, and the role of economic literacy as a mitigation tool. Using a systematic literature review approach, this research analyzes scholarly articles published between 2018 and 2025 from reputable sources. The findings indicate that macroeconomic pressure significantly contributes to doom spending behavior, and economic literacy plays an essential role in shaping rational consumer decision-making. However, economic literacy alone is insufficient without self-regulation and digital awareness of consumerist influences. This study highlights the urgency of enhancing economic literacy programs that are adaptive to digital challenges and macroeconomic dynamics. Abstract

The purpose of this study is to analyze the relationship between education level and income level on tax compliance through self-assessment. The study was conducted on the Srikandi Women's Business Group (UMKM) in Bojongsari Village, Bojongsari District, Purbalingga Regency, with 45 members. The sample size used in this study was 45. The sampling method used was saturated sampling. The data obtained were analyzed using path analysis. The results indicate that education level has a direct effect on self-assessment, while income level does not. Both education and income levels positively influence tax compliance. In addition, self-assessment serves as a mediating variable that strengthens the relationship between education and income levels and tax compliance.

Abstract

This study aims to examine the effect of financial distress and profitability on earnings management with audit quality as a moderating variable in basic materials sector companies list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ange (IDX). The population of this study consists of 103 basic materials sector companies. Out of 103 companies, only 38 companies met the criteria. The observation period for this study spans 3 years, from 2021 to 2023, resulting in a final data of 114 companies. Sampling was conducted using the purposive sampling technique. The study employs Moderated Regression Analysis (MRA) processed through the IBM SPSS 27 application. The results show that, partially, financial distress has a significant negative effect on earnings management, profitability has a significant positive effect on earnings management, audit quality strengthens the effect of financial distress on earnings management, and audit quality does not moderate the effect of profitability on earnings management. Investors and creditors should be more cautious in allocating and lending their funds. They should also consider audit quality in their decision-making process.

Abstract

This study aims to empirically determine and examine the effect of profitability, capital structure, firm size, and company growth on firm value as measured by Tobins’Q. The population in this study are technology sector companies list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ange (IDX) in the period 2021 to 2023, namely 27 companies. This study uses secondary data obtained from the company’s financial statements and this type of research is quantitative research. Determination of the sample using purposive sampling method using certain criteria and obtained 11 technology sector companies are obtained as research samples. The data analysis method used is multiple linear regression analysis using the IBM SPSS version 25 program. The results of this study indicate that profitability measured by Return on Equity (ROE) has a significant positive effect on firm value. Meanwhile, capital structure measured by Debt to Equity (DER) have no effect on firm value. Firm size have no effect on firm value. And company growth have no effect on firm value.
